What class of stones for riprap ranges from 60 kgs to a maximum of 100 kgs with at least 50% weighing more than 80 kgs?

Explanation:
The correct classification for riprap stones that weigh between 60 kgs and a maximum of 100 kgs, with at least 50% of the stones weighing more than 80 kgs, is Class C. Riprap is commonly used for erosion control, and specific classes are defined by the size and weight of the stones used. Class C is identified by its specific weight range, which adheres to the requirement of having a mix where a considerable portion exceeds 80 kgs—this size ensures adequate resistance to erosion in the applications for which riprap is intended. The designated weight limits for Class C make it suitable for various environmental conditions where protections against water flow or weathering are necessary. Understanding these classifications is crucial for engineers when designing structures that will be exposed to hydraulic forces, ensuring the appropriate materials are selected for stability and longevity in such applications.
